Full time, Term-time only (41 weeks)

The Department of Classics at Royal Holloway University of London seeks to appoint TWO (2) permanent, term-time only (41 weeks) Language Tutors beginning on 2 September 2024

The two appointees will be expected to have a proven record of excellence in teaching Greek and Latin, or, in the case of early-career candidates, relevant experience and demonstrable potential.

The appointees will be expected to play a full and active role in teaching in the Department of Classics. They will be required to teach, convene, and examine undergraduate courses in Classical Greek and Latin at all levels, to contribute to administrative duties and to attend relevant meetings and committees as required. They will work closely with the Head of Department, the UG Education Lead and other academic members of staff, in areas including curriculum design, lesson planning, and the development and implementation of learning technologies.

Applicants should have experience of teaching Classical Greek and Latin language, at Beginners and Intermediate levels, and ideally to undergraduates in a university environment. They should have a high-level command of Classical Greek and Latin and a strong and demonstrable commitment to teaching.
